Page 73 of 432

After entering the vehicle during a
remote start, insert and turn the key
to the ON/RUN position to drive
the vehicle.
If the vehicle is left running it
automatically shuts off after
10 minutes unless a time extension
has been done.
To manually shut off a remote start:
Aim the RKE transmitter at the
vehicle and press
/until the
parking lamps turn off.
Turn on the hazard warning
ashers.
Turn the ignition switch on and
then off.
The vehicle can be started using the
remote start feature two separate
times between driving sequences.
The engine runs for 10 minutes after
each remote start. Or, the engine
run time can be extended another10 minutes within the rst 10 minute
remote start time frame, and
before the engine stops.
For example, if
Qand then/are
pressed again after the vehicle
has been running for ve minutes,
10 minutes are added, allowing
the engine to run for 15 minutes.
The additional 10 minutes are
considered a second remote start.
The vehicle must be started with the
key once two remote starts, or a
single remote start with one
time extension has been done.
The vehicle can be started using the
remote start feature again after
the key is removed from the ignition.
The vehicle cannot be started
using the remote start feature if the
key is in the ignition, the hood is
open, or if there is an emission
control system malfunction.The engine turns off during a
remote start if the coolant
temperature gets too high or if the
oil pressure gets low.
Vehicles that have the remote
vehicle start feature are shipped
from the factory with the remote
vehicle start system enabled.
The system may be enabled or
disabled through the DIC if the
vehicle has DIC buttons. See
“REMOTE START” underDIC
Vehicle Customization (With DIC
Buttons) on page 3-65for additional
information. If the vehicle does
not have DIC buttons, see your
dealer/retailer to enable or disable
the remote start system.

Starting the Engine
Move the shift lever to P (Park) or
N (Neutral). The engine will not start
in any other position. To restart the
engine when the vehicle is already
moving, use N (Neutral) only.
Notice:Do not try to shift to
P (Park) if the vehicle is moving.
If you do, you could damage
the transmission. Shift to P (Park)
only when the vehicle is stopped.
Starting Procedure
1. With your foot off the
accelerator pedal, turn the
ignition to START. When the
engine starts, let go of the key.
The idle speed will slow down
as the engine warms. Do not
race the engine immediately after
starting it. Operate the engine
and transmission gently to allow
the oil to warm up and lubricate
all moving parts.The vehicle has a
Computer-Controlled
Cranking System. This feature
assists in starting the engine
and protects components.
If the ignition key is turned to
the START position, and
then released when the engine
begins cranking, the engine
will continue cranking for a
few seconds or until the vehicle
starts. If the engine does not
start and the key is held in
START, cranking will be stopped
after 15 seconds to prevent
cranking motor damage.
To prevent gear damage, this
system also prevents cranking if
the engine is already running.
Engine cranking can be stopped
by turning the ignition switch
to the ACC/ACCESSORY
or LOCK/OFF position.Notice:Cranking the engine for
long periods of time, by returning
the key to the START position
immediately after cranking has
ended, can overheat and damage
the cranking motor, and drain the
battery. Wait at least 15 seconds
between each try, to let the
cranking motor cool down.
2. If the engine does not start
after 5-10 seconds, especially
in very cold weather (below 0°F
or−18°C), it could be ooded
with too much gasoline.
Try pushing the accelerator
pedal all the way to the oor
and holding it there as you hold
the key in START for up to a
maximum of 15 seconds.
Wait at least 15 seconds
between each try, to allow the
cranking motor to cool down.
When the engine starts, let go
of the key and accelerator.
2-22 Features and Controls
ProCarManuals.com

Page 89 of 432

If the vehicle starts briey but
then stops again, repeat these
steps. This clears the extra
gasoline from the engine. Do not
race the engine immediately
after starting it. Operate the
engine and transmission gently
until the oil warms up and
lubricates all moving parts.
Notice:The engine is designed
to work with the electronics
in the vehicle. If you add electrical
parts or accessories, you could
change the way the engine
operates. Before adding electrical
equipment, check with your
dealer/retailer. If you do not,
the engine might not perform
properly. Any resulting damage
would not be covered by the
vehicle warranty.Engine Coolant Heater
The engine coolant heater can
provide easier starting and better
fuel economy during engine
warm-up in cold weather conditions
at or below 0°F (−18°C). Vehicles
with an engine coolant heater should
be plugged in at least four hours
before starting. Some models
may have an internal thermostat
in the cord which will prevent
engine coolant heater operation at
temperatures above 0°F (−18°C).
To Use the Engine Coolant
Heater
1. Turn off the engine.
2. Open the hood and unwrap the
electrical cord. The cord is
located on the driver side of the
engine compartment. It is
routed around the windshield
washer uid reservoir.
3. Plug the cord into a normal,
grounded 110-volt AC outlet.
{CAUTION
Plugging the cord into an
ungrounded outlet could cause an
electrical shock. Also, the wrong
kind of extension cord could
overheat and cause a re. You
could be seriously injured. Plug
the cord into a properly grounded
three-prong 110-volt AC outlet.
If the cord will not reach, use a
heavy-duty three-prong extension
cord rated for at least 15 amps.
4. Before starting the engine, be
sure to unplug and store the
cord as it was before to keep it
away from moving engine
parts. If you do not, it could be
damaged.
The length of time the heater should
remain plugged in depends on
several factors. Ask a dealer/retailer
in the area where you will be
parking the vehicle for the best
advice on this.

Emissions Inspection and
Maintenance Programs
Some state/provincial and local
governments have or might begin
programs to inspect the emission
control equipment on the vehicle.
Failure to pass this inspection
could prevent getting a vehicle
registration.
Here are some things to know to
help the vehicle pass an inspection:
The vehicle will not pass this
inspection if the check engine
light is on with the engine running,
or if the key is in ON/RUN and the
light is not on.
The vehicle will not pass this
inspection if the OBD II (on-board
diagnostic) system determines
that critical emission control
systems have not been
completely diagnosed by the
system. The vehicle would
be considered not ready forinspection. This can happen
if the battery has recently been
replaced or if the battery has run
down. The diagnostic system
is designed to evaluate critical
emission control systems during
normal driving. This can take
several days of routine driving.
If this has been done and the
vehicle still does not pass the
inspection for lack of OBD II
system readiness, your dealer/
retailer can prepare the vehicle
for inspection.
Oil Pressure Light
{CAUTION
Do not keep driving if the oil
pressure is low. The engine can
become so hot that it catches re.
Someone could be burned. Check
the oil as soon as possible and
have the vehicle serviced.Notice:Lack of proper engine
oil maintenance can damage
the engine. The repairs would
not be covered by the vehicle
warranty. Always follow the
maintenance schedule in this
manual for changing engine oil.
The oil pressure light should come
on briey as the engine is started. If it
does not come on have the vehicle
serviced by your dealer/retailer.
If the light comes on and stays on, it
means that oil is not owing through
the engine properly. The vehicle
could be low on oil and might have
some other system problem.

Trip Odometer Reset Stem
Menu Items
ODOMETER
Press the trip odometer reset
stem until ODOMETER displays.
This display shows the distance
the vehicle has been driven in
either miles (mi) or kilometers (km).
To switch between English and
metric measurements, see “UNITS”
later in this section.TRIP A or TRIP B
Press the trip odometer reset stem
until TRIP A or TRIP B displays.
This display shows the current
distance traveled in either miles (mi)
or kilometers (km) since the last
reset for each trip odometer. Both
trip odometers can be used at the
same time.
Each trip odometer can be reset
to zero separately by pressing and
holding the trip odometer reset
stem while the desired trip odometer
is displayed.
The trip odometer has a feature
called the retro-active reset.
This can be used to set the trip
odometer to the number of miles
(kilometers) driven since the ignition
was last turned on. This can be
used if the trip odometer is not
reset at the beginning of the trip.To use the retro-active reset feature,
press and hold the trip odometer
reset stem for at least four seconds.
The trip odometer will display
the number of miles (mi) or
kilometers (km) driven since the
ignition was last turned on and
the vehicle was moving. Once the
vehicle begins moving, the trip
odometer will accumulate mileage.
For example, if the vehicle was
driven 5 miles (8 km) before it
is started again, and then the
retro-active reset feature is activated,
the display will show 5 miles (8 km).
As the vehicle begins moving, the
display will then increase to 5.1 miles
(8.2 km), 5.2 miles (8.4 km), etc.
If the retro-active reset feature is
activated after the vehicle is started,
but before it begins moving, the
display will show the number of
miles (mi) or kilometers (km)
that were driven during the last
ignition cycle.

BATTERY SAVER ACTIVE
This message displays when the
system detects that the battery
voltage is dropping below expected
levels. The battery saver system
starts reducing certain features of
the vehicle that you may be able to
notice. At the point that the features
are disabled, this message is
displayed. It means that the vehicle
is trying to save the charge in the
battery.
Turn off all unnecessary accessories
to allow the battery to recharge.
The normal battery voltage range is
11.5 to 15.5 volts.
CHANGE ENGINE OIL SOON
This message displays when the
engine oil needs to be changed.
When you change the engine oil, be
sure to reset the CHANGE ENGINE
OIL SOON message. SeeEngine
Oil Life System on page 5-15for
information on how to reset themessage. SeeEngine Oil on
page 5-13andScheduled
Maintenance on page 6-3for
more information.
CHECK TIRE PRESSURE
On vehicles with the TirePressure
Monitor System (TPMS), this
message displays when the pressure
in one or more of the vehicle’s tires
needs to be checked. This message
also displays LEFT FRONT, RIGHT
FRONT, LEFT REAR, or RIGHT
REAR to indicate which tire needs to
be checked. You can receive more
than one tire pressure message at a
time. To read the other messages
that may have been sent at the same
time, press the set/reset button or
the trip odometer reset stem. If a tire
pressure message appears on the
DIC, stop as soon as you can. Have
the tire pressures checked and set
to those shown on the Tire Loading
Information label. SeeTires on
page 5-39,Loading the Vehicleon page 4-18, andInflation - Tire
Pressure on page 5-45. The DIC
also shows the tire pressure values.
See “DIC Operation and Displays
(With DIC Buttons)” earlier in this
section. If the tire pressure is low,
the low tire pressure warning light
comes on. SeeTire Pressure Light
on page 3-39.
CRUISE SET TO XXX
This message displays whenever
the cruise control is set. SeeCruise
Control on page 3-9for more
information.
DRIVER DOOR OPEN
This message displays and a
chime sounds if the driver door
is not fully closed and the vehicle
is shifted out of P (Park). Stop and
turn off the vehicle, check the door
for obstructions, and close the door
again. Check to see if the message
still appears on the DIC.
